Where was Benicio Del Toro born?
Benicio Del Toro was born on February 19, 1967, in San Juan, Puerto Rico. This makes him a Puerto Rican by birth. Puerto Rico, an unincorporated territory of the United States, has a rich and diverse cultural heritage, influenced by its indigenous Taíno, Spanish, and African roots.
